Table 3 Short list of tips and resources for making genetic diagnoses in child psychiatry

From: Overview: referrals for genetic evaluation from child psychiatrists

1.

Take a family history

2.

Measure and plot head circumference percentiles

3.

Inspect the skin

4.

Take note of dysmorphic features

5.

Know your genetics referral colleagues

6.
